One of Armenian's toughest fighters will take to the Octagon on Saturday as Arman Tsarukyan (16-2) takes to the main card as the night's biggest favorite when he faces Christos Giagos. Since joining the UFC in April of 2019, Tsarukyan has gone 3-1, with that lone loss coming in his debut to Islam Makhachev, which is no loss to be ashamed of. Tsarukyan can truly finish the bout by any of the three methods, with five wins by knockout/TKO, five by submission and six by decision. Riding a three-fight winning streak, DraftKings sees Tsarukyan as the night's biggest favorite with a salary of $9,600. It should be noted that all of his UFC wins have come by decision, and Giagos should give him a tough fight. Buyer beware of the $9,600 price tag!--Matt Bricker
